On my last pedalboard, I used a 2x6 plank and cut it down to fit across the pedalboard. Here is my old one for reference. The 2x6 plank sits under the top row of pedals (Route 66, Volume, Chorus, delays). It makes it to where I don't accidentally step on on of the other pedals.
